Machakos Governor Dr. Alfred Mutua has been praised by motorists for his hands-on approach in managing traffic during the Masaku Sevens International Rugby Bonanza.

Apart from his development efforts in the county, Mutua spent over four hours directing traffic to prevent a major jam, ensuring a smooth experience for drivers.

Unlike the previous year's event, which was marred by massive traffic jams lasting over eight hours, Mutua took charge of traffic management at key points in Machakos town.

According to his spokesperson and Press Secretary, Mutinda Mwanzia, Mutua was watching rugby at the Kenyatta Stadium when he was alerted to the building congestion in the town center. Upon realizing that police would not arrive in time, Mutua decided to take matters into his own hands.

"Dr. Mutua made a few phone calls and when he realized that by the time the police showed up, the smooth flow enjoyed so far would be lost, he hit the road and used his wits to ensure that there was no snarl up," said Mutinda Mwanzia.

Motorist Tevin Kitheka expressed gratitude towards the Governor, stating, "We are so happy to see our Governor caring about our welfare. Last year was a nightmare on the roads."

Mutua implemented measures to divert traffic, closing certain roads and redirecting revelers to the People’s Park, one of his flagship projects.

The event saw significant improvements in traffic flow and behavior among attendees compared to the previous year.

"I wish to thank all those who participated in the event and pledge that next year it will be bigger and better," said Mutua.

Mutua was later joined by the County Security team, led by County Police Commander Jacinta Wesonga, and together they managed traffic until 2 a.m.
